SEN Teacher
Location: Wareham
Salary: £31,650 - £49,084 per annum (MPS/UPS) (Depending on Experience)
Start Date: September 2025
Contract Type: Permanent / Full-time
Are you a compassionate and driven teacher looking to make a lasting impact in the lives of children with special educational needs?
GSL Education are seeking an enthusiastic and resilient SEN Teacher to join a well-respected specialist school in Wareham.
About the Role:
As a Special Educational Needs Teacher, you will be teaching students with a range of additional needs such as ASD, ADHD, speech and language difficulties, and SEMH. Your role will involve delivering personalised learning, fostering a positive learning environment, and supporting pupils' emotional and social development alongside academic progress.
